[QUOTE="TopFrog, post: 3145828, member: 120"] [B][SIZE=6]TCU Horned Frogs (21-11, 7-5 Big 12) at #16 Dallas Baptist Patriots (21-10, 3-0 MVC)[/SIZE] GAME DAY INFORMATION[/B] Location: Austin, Texas Field: Hoerner Ballpark TV: Bally Sports SW/ESPN+ (Non-local) Radio: KTCU 88.7 FM Live Stats: GoFrogs.com Live Video: WatchESPN Twitter: @TCU_Baseball Instagram: [USER=44126]@tcubaseball[/USER] Facebook: [URL="http://www.facebook.com/TCUBaseball"]www.facebook.com/TCUBaseball[/URL] [B]TCU HORNED FROGS[/B] Record: 21-11 Away Record: 6-6 Big 12: 7-5 Head Coach: Kirk Saarloos [B]DALLAS BAPTIST PATRIOTS[/B] Record: 21-10 Home Record: 14-6 MVC: 3-0 Head Coach: Dan Heefner [B]GAME INFORMATION[/B] Friday • April 12 • 6:30 p.m. Caedmon Parker vs. Zach Heaton [B]TCU NOTABLES[/B] • TCU is 2-2 on its current five game road trip after dropping a road series at No. 7 Texas over the weekend. • The Horned Frogs are 11-7 away from home this season, including a 6-6 mark in true road games. • The TCU bullpen has allowed just three earned runs in its last 26 2/3 innings pitched spanning six games. • TCU sits sixth in the league in hitting (.268), fifth in ERA (4.43) and fourth in fielding percentage (.977). • TCU has drawn 197 walks this season, a mark that is sixth nationally. • TCU has turned 27 double plays this season, the second-most in the Big 12. • Tommy Sacco has reached base safely in nine straight plate appearances (6 hits, 3 walks). • Elijah Nunez is now 17-for-17 in stolen bases, a total that ranks tied for 27th in the nation. • David Bishop ranks third among NCAA freshmen with 37 RBIs. • River Ridings picked up his ninth save of the season, a mark that is tied for fourth nationally. • Brayden Taylor has homered in back-to-back games and now has seven on the season. • Taylor continues to lead the nation in total walks (36) and Elijah Nunez ranks tied for 12th with 31. [B]ROAD NOTABLES[/B] • TCU will play 22 road games this season. • TCU is 6-6 away from home this year. • TCU has won 26 of 47 road series since Kirk Saarloos’ arrival in 2013. • TCU is 25-12 in road midweek games under Saarloos. • TCU is 107-81 on the road with Saarloos on staff. • TCU has been above .500 on the road in six of Saarloos’ nine seasons on staff.
